Docker Testing and Gramps
I came across this cool piece of software called Gramps Web. It is a self hostable Geneaology program. I do not do geneaology, but a relative does. So for fun, I decided to set it up but I put my own spin on it.
I wanted to put it into a VM to containerize it, but did not want to deal with that. I thought docker would be easier, but it kind of creates a mess of files with the host system which is more annoying than a single disk image for a VM.
So I thought why not use a single disk image for docker? Just put everything in that disk image.
I ran a few commands to create a virtual disk:
dd if=/dev/zero of=./testGramps.img bs=1M count=2000
mkfs -t ext4 ./testGramps.img
resize2fs testGramps.img -m #to get rid of all the zeros that I filled it with
e2fsck -f testGramps.img & resize2fs testGramps.img 2G #get back to 2G
mount testGramps.img <<mountPoint>>
Then I created my directory structure of:
mountPoint
-> docker-compose.yml
-> data
---> cache
---> db
---> index
---> media
---> secret
---> thumb_cache
---> tmp
---> users
Then I used the gramps docker compose file and added my directories as bind mounts. I also mapped the port to 5001 since idk if 80 is already being used on my system and I want to avoid headaches if possible.
Then I ran docker compose up
while in the correct directory and it worked perfectly!!

So I fixed by transferring the entire disk image to another computer (specifically the new one running fedora) and set it up again. Since everything was isolated into that one image, it was plug and play!!
